.tools-head.svelte-1o1rqqy{border-bottom:1px solid var(--color-border);padding-block:48px 24px}.tools-search.svelte-1o1rqqy{border:1px solid var(--color-border-2);background:var(--color-surface-2);width:100%;max-width:480px;color:var(--color-ink-2);border-radius:0;margin-top:20px;padding:12px 16px;font-size:14px}.tools-search.svelte-1o1rqqy:focus{border-color:var(--color-brand);background:var(--color-surface);outline:none}.tools-layout.svelte-1o1rqqy{grid-template-columns:200px 1fr;align-items:start;gap:40px;display:grid}.tools-filters.svelte-1o1rqqy{flex-direction:column;gap:28px;display:flex;position:sticky;top:90px}.filter-heading.svelte-1o1rqqy{font-family:var(--font-mono);text-transform:uppercase;letter-spacing:.06em;color:var(--color-ink-4);margin-bottom:10px;font-size:10.5px;font-weight:600}.filter-group.svelte-1o1rqqy{flex-direction:column;gap:4px;display:flex}.filter-item.svelte-1o1rqqy{color:var(--color-ink-3);text-align:left;border-radius:0;padding:6px 8px;font-size:13.5px}.filter-item.svelte-1o1rqqy:hover{background:var(--color-surface-2)}.filter-item-active.svelte-1o1rqqy{background:var(--color-brand-soft);color:var(--color-brand);font-weight:600}.filter-clear.svelte-1o1rqqy{color:var(--color-brand);text-align:left;padding:6px 8px;font-size:12.5px}.tools-grid.svelte-1o1rqqy{grid-template-columns:repeat(2,1fr);gap:18px;display:grid}.tools-empty.svelte-1o1rqqy{color:var(--color-ink-4);padding:40px 0;font-size:14px}.tool-card.svelte-1o1rqqy{border:1px solid var(--color-border);flex-direction:column;gap:10px;padding:20px 22px;display:flex}.tool-card-top.svelte-1o1rqqy{justify-content:space-between;align-items:flex-start;gap:10px;display:flex}.tool-name.svelte-1o1rqqy{font-family:var(--font-serif);color:var(--color-ink);font-size:1.05rem}.tool-badges.svelte-1o1rqqy{flex-wrap:wrap;flex-shrink:0;gap:6px;display:flex}.tool-badge.svelte-1o1rqqy{font-family:var(--font-mono);text-transform:uppercase;letter-spacing:.04em;border:1px solid var(--color-border-2);color:var(--color-ink-3);white-space:nowrap;padding:3px 7px;font-size:9.5px;font-weight:600}.tool-badge-lang.svelte-1o1rqqy{background:var(--color-surface-2)}.tool-badge-license.svelte-1o1rqqy{background:var(--color-brand-soft);color:var(--color-brand);border-color:var(--color-brand-soft-2)}.tool-usage.svelte-1o1rqqy{color:var(--color-ink-4);font-size:12.5px}.tool-examples.svelte-1o1rqqy{flex-wrap:wrap;gap:6px 10px;display:flex}.tool-example.svelte-1o1rqqy{color:var(--color-ink-3);border-bottom:1px solid var(--color-border-2);font-size:12.5px}.tool-example.svelte-1o1rqqy:hover{color:var(--color-brand);border-color:var(--color-brand)}.tool-example-more.svelte-1o1rqqy{color:var(--color-ink-5);font-size:12.5px}.tool-actions.svelte-1o1rqqy{gap:16px;margin-top:auto;padding-top:6px;display:flex}.tool-action.svelte-1o1rqqy{color:var(--color-brand);font-size:12.5px;font-weight:700}.tool-action-ext.svelte-1o1rqqy{color:var(--color-ink-3)}@media (width<=980px){.tools-layout.svelte-1o1rqqy{grid-template-columns:1fr}.tools-filters.svelte-1o1rqqy{position:static}.tools-grid.svelte-1o1rqqy{grid-template-columns:1fr}}
